The Ginger Pig Cafe, London

The Ginger Pig Cafe is a bold, meat-forward spot where Hoxton's gritty charm, East London creativity, and no-nonsense comfort food come together in a setting that feels casual, flavorful, and unapologetically hearty.

Set on Hoxton Street, just a short walk from Hoxton Station and surrounded by independent shops, cafΓ©s, and street-level culture, this cafΓ© sits in one of East London's most authentic, lived-in neighborhoods, where the pace feels local and the energy is best known for the community. From the outside, it's approachable and straightforward, but stepping inside reveals a space that leans compact and relaxed, with a focus that immediately shifts to what's coming out of the kitchen. There's an instant sense of purpose, orders being made fresh, plates moving quickly, and a crowd that feels like it knows exactly why it's there. It's a place where the experience is driven by flavor over formality.

The Ginger Pig Cafe is best known for high-quality meat and simple execution, offering dishes that highlight strong ingredients.

The concept is closely tied to the well-known Ginger Pig brand, known for its premium butchery, which carries through into the menu with a focus on burgers, sandwiches, and hearty plates that emphasize quality cuts.
